Hi Marc, On Thu, Jul 15, 2021 at 5:12 PM Marc Kleine-Budde <mkl@xxxxxxxxxxxxxx> wrote: > > On 15.07.2021 16:25:30, Dong Aisheng wrote: > > This patch fixes the following errors during make dtbs_check: > > arch/arm64/boot/dts/freescale/imx8mp-evk.dt.yaml: can@308c0000: compatible: 'oneOf' conditional failed, one must be fixed: > > ['fsl,imx8mp-flexcan', 'fsl,imx6q-flexcan'] is too long > > IIRC the fsl,imx6q-flexcan binding doesn't work on the imx8mp. Maybe > better change the dtsi? I checked with Joakim that the flexcan on MX8MP is derived from MX6Q with extra ECC added. Maybe we should still keep it from HW point of view? Regards Aisheng > > regards, > Marc > > -- > Pengutronix e.K. | Marc Kleine-Budde | > Embedded Linux | https://www.pengutronix.de | > Vertretung West/Dortmund | Phone: +49-231-2826-924 | > Amtsgericht Hildesheim, HRA 2686 | Fax: +49-5121-206917-5555 |